    Methods in io.nayuki.qrcodegen with parameters of type QrCode.Ecc
    Modifier and Type Method Description
    static QrCode QrCode.encodeBinary​(byte[] data, QrCode.Ecc ecl)
    Returns a QR Code representing the specified binary data at the specified error correction level.
    static QrCode QrCode.encodeSegments​(java.util.List<QrSegment> segs, QrCode.Ecc ecl)
    Returns a QR Code representing the specified segments at the specified error correction level.
    static QrCode QrCode.encodeSegments​(java.util.List<QrSegment> segs, QrCode.Ecc ecl, int minVersion, int maxVersion, int mask, boolean boostEcl)
    Returns a QR Code representing the specified segments with the specified encoding parameters.
    static QrCode QrCode.encodeText​(java.lang.String text, QrCode.Ecc ecl)
    Returns a QR Code representing the specified Unicode text string at the specified error correction level.
    static java.util.List<QrSegment> QrSegmentAdvanced.makeSegmentsOptimally​(java.lang.String text, QrCode.Ecc ecl, int minVersion, int maxVersion)
    Returns a list of zero or more segments to represent the specified Unicode text string.
